你的浏览器版本过低,可能导致网站不能正常访问!
为了你能正常使用网站功能,请使用这些浏览器。

hal有没有复位所有寄存器的函数或者demo?

[复制链接]
吃绿色菜 提问时间:2023-12-28 21:32 / 未解决

本人用的STM32G0B1,我想boot跳转后,先清理寄存器.hal有没有复位所有寄存器的函数或者demo?

收藏 评论2 发布时间:2023-12-28 21:32

举报

2个回答
butterflyspring 回答时间:2023-12-29 10:26:27
这个还真没看见有。
目前只有芯片系统复位才可以复位所有的寄存器。

xmshao 回答时间:2023-12-29 11:12:39
每个STM32系列都有相关寄存器和应用函数。以G0系列为例:


  __HAL_RCC_APB1_FORCE_RESET();  __HAL_RCC_APB1_RELEASE_RESET();


  __HAL_RCC_APB2_FORCE_RESET();
  __HAL_RCC_APB2_RELEASE_RESET();


  __HAL_RCC_AHB_FORCE_RESET();
  __HAL_RCC_AHB_RELEASE_RESET();


  __HAL_RCC_IOP_FORCE_RESET();
  __HAL_RCC_IOP_RELEASE_RESET();
关于意法半导体
我们是谁
投资者关系
意法半导体可持续发展举措
创新和工艺
招聘信息
联系我们
联系ST分支机构
寻找销售人员和分销渠道
社区
媒体中心
活动与培训
隐私策略
隐私策略
Cookies管理
行使您的权利
关注我们
st-img 微信公众号
st-img 手机版